Abstract:
A semiconductor device includes drain and source regions positioned in an active region of a transistor and a channel region positioned laterally between the drain and source regions that includes a semiconductor base material and a threshold voltage adjusting semiconductor material positioned on the semiconductor base material. A gate electrode structure is positioned on the threshold voltage adjusting semiconductor material, and a strain-inducing semiconductor alloy including a first semiconductor material and a second semiconductor material positioned above the first semiconductor material is embedded in the semiconductor base material of the active region. A crystalline buffer layer of a third semiconductor material surrounds the embedded strain-inducing semiconductor alloy, wherein an upper portion of the crystalline buffer layer laterally confines the channel region including the sidewalls of the threshold voltage adjusting semiconductor material and is positioned between the second semiconductor material and the threshold voltage adjusting semiconductor material.
Abstract:
A semiconductor device includes a plurality of spaced apart fins, a dielectric material layer positioned between each of the plurality of spaced apart fins, and a common gate structure positioned above the dielectric material layer and extending across the fins. A continuous merged semiconductor material region is positioned on each of the fins and above the dielectric material layer, is laterally spaced apart from the common gate structure, extends between and physically contacts the fins, has a first sidewall surface that faces toward the common gate structure, and has a second sidewall surface that is opposite of the first sidewall surface and faces away from the common gate structure. A stress-inducing material is positioned in a space defined by at least the first sidewall surface, opposing sidewall surfaces of an adjacent pair of fins, and an upper surface of the dielectric material layer.
Abstract:
The present disclosure provides a method of forming a semiconductor device and a semiconductor device. An SOI substrate portion having a semiconductor layer, a buried insulating material layer and a bulk substrate is provided, wherein the buried insulating material layer is interposed between the semiconductor layer and the bulk substrate. The SOI substrate portion is subsequently patterned so as to form a patterned bi-layer stack on the bulk substrate, which bi-layer stack comprises a patterned semiconductor layer and a patterned buried insulating material layer. The bi-layer stack is further enclosed with a further insulating material layer and an electrode material is formed on and around the further insulating material layer. Herein a gate electrode is formed by the bulk substrate and the electrode material such that the gate electrode substantially surrounds a channel portion formed by a portion of the patterned buried insulating material layer.
Abstract:
A semiconductor product with certain devices having a first device with a fully silicided (FuSi) gate and a second device with a partially silicided gate is disclosed. In one example, the first semiconductor device is recessed, resulting in a recessed first gate electrode material which is fully silicided during a subsequent silicidation process. On the gate electrode material of the second semiconductor device, a silicide portion is formed above a layer of polysilicon or amorphous silicon during the silicidation process.

Abstract:
Semiconductor device structures and methods for forming a semiconductor device are provided. In embodiments, one or more fins are provided, each of the one or more fins having a lower portion and an upper portion disposed on the lower portion. The lower portion is embedded in a first insulating material. The shape of the upper portion is at least one of a substantially triangular shape and a substantially rounded shape and a substantially trapezoidal shape. Furthermore, a layer of a second insulating material different from the first insulating material is formed on the upper portion.
Abstract:
Methods for fabricating an integrated circuit are provided herein. In an embodiment, a method for fabricating an integrated circuit includes forming a gate electrode structure overlying a semiconductor substrate. A first sacrificial oxide layer is formed overlying the semiconductor substrate and a first implant mask is patterned overlying the first sacrificial oxide layer to expose a portion of the first sacrificial oxide layer adjacent the gate electrode structure. Conductivity determining ions are implanted into the semiconductor substrate, through the first sacrificial oxide layer. The first implant mask and the first sacrificial oxide layer are removed after implanting the conductivity determining ions into the semiconductor substrate.
Abstract:
Semiconductor devices are formed without full silicidation of the gates and with independent adjustment of silicides in the gates and source/drain regions. Embodiments include forming a gate on a substrate, forming a nitride cap on the gate, forming a source/drain region on each side of the gate, forming a first silicide in each source/drain region, removing the nitride cap subsequent to the formation of the first silicide, and forming a second silicide in the source/drain regions and in the gate, subsequent to removing the nitride cap. Embodiments include forming the first silicide by forming a first metal layer on the source/drain regions and performing a first RTA, and forming the second silicide by forming a second metal layer on the source/drain regions and on the gate and performing a second RTA.
